## Releases

RouteNimbus ships the driver-assignment heuristic as a versioned module, and plugin authors should pin to a minor release rather than tracking main. The heuristic's scoring weights can shift between patch versions, so validate your plugin's tie-breaking logic against the published fixture set before each upgrade. Release tarballs are built reproducibly and signed by the Harborline release robot. Verify every download against the key below before loading it into your plugin sandbox.

signing key of bagap-yawep = bky13_TbfT6ZMUoGJo2

## Deployment

Graphloom, the dependency graph visualizer, deploys as a single container behind the Eastvale ingress. Rollouts are rolling with a max surge of one, so brief render delays during deploys are expected and not pageable. The graph cache rebuilds automatically within five minutes of startup; do not restart the pod during that window. On-call engineers should confirm the running instance matches the values below.

settings of fafog-haduf:
ZORIX_PIN=4648
ZORIX_METRICS_HOST=metrics.zorix.paliqsys.corp
ZORIX_LOG_LEVEL=info
ZORIX_TENANT=druix

Subject: Cleaning crew access — overnight arrangements

Hi all,

From Monday, the Sparrowdale cleaning crew will service floors 3–5 between 23:30 and 03:00. Night-shift colleagues, please expect them at the service corridor door rather than the lobby, and check their rota sheet against the list pinned at the desk before letting anyone through. If nobody is at the desk when they arrive, they may let themselves in using the door code below.

Front Desk, Harrowgate Point

turnstile pass: bdg-QZV-3

Handing over the PayTrellis release covering idempotency keys for payment retries. The change ensures each retry reuses the original request key, so duplicate captures are impossible even under gateway timeouts. Security review items: key generation is server-side only, keys expire after 48 hours, and the audit log records every reuse. The remaining step is the signed deployment to the settlement cluster, which the pipeline verifies before rollout. For verification, the deploy signing key is included below.

signing key of kahog-kadup = bky13_6wLyxnPsJob4P